The Largest Trade in Baseball History

In the wake of Giancarlo Stanton's move to the Yankees and the Winter Meetings, Pinstripe Alley printed a story on the largest trade in baseball history by number of players. It was between the Yankees and Orioles in 1954. Don Larsen and Bob Turley are the two significant names in this trade.
